20110069376 | FIBER MOPA WITH AMPLIFYING TRANSPORT FIBER - Frequency-multiplied fiber-MOPA apparatus includes one enclosure containing a master oscillator and fiber amplifier stages and another enclosure containing frequency-multiplying stages. Radiation is transmitted between the enclosures by a transport fiber in a flexible jacket or enclosure. The transport fiber functions additionally as a power amplifier fiber, and amplifies the radiation while transporting the radiation between the enclosures. The amplifying transport fiber is energized by diode-lasers in the enclosure containing the master oscillator and fiber amplifiers. | 03-24-2011 |

20120300287 | FREQUENCY-TRIPLED FIBER MOPA - Fundamental-wavelength pulses from a fiber a laser are divided into three or more pulse portions and the three or more portions are separately amplified. Two or more of the amplified fundamental-wavelength pulse-portions are combined and frequency-doubled. The frequency doubled portion is sum-frequency mixed with one or more of the other amplified fundamental wavelength pulse-portions to provide third-harmonic radiation pulses. | 11-29-2012 |

20150338719 | CASCADED OPTICAL HARMONIC GENERATION - Cascaded optical harmonic generators and methods for cascaded optical harmonic generation are disclosed. Relative disposition of individual harmonic generators of a cascaded harmonic generator in an optical path of the fundamental optical beam may be reversed. In a third harmonic generator, the fundamental optical beam may enter the third harmonic crystal first, and the second harmonic crystal second. When the fundamental optical beam enters the third harmonic crystal first, the fundamental light may remain non-depleted by second harmonic generation process. | 11-26-2015 |
